- WHAT IS GLIMPSE
- Glimpse (which stands for GLobal IMPlicit SEarch) is an indexing and
- query system that allows you to search through lots of files in many
- (possibly nested) directories very quickly.
- Glimpseindex, which you run by saying glimpseindex <directory(ies)>
- builds a very small index (2-5% of the text).
- With it, glimpse can search through all the files in these directories
- much the same way as grep, except that you don't have to specify file
- names. Glimpse supports most of agrep's options (agrep is our
- powerful version of grep, and it is part of glimpse) including
- approximate matching (e.g., finding misspelled words), Boolean queries,
- and even some limited forms of regular expressions.

- DESCRIPTION
- GlimpseHTTP is a collection of tools that allows you to incorporate
- glimpse in WWW documents. With it, you can provide general
- search capabilities to any user without incurring too much space
- overhead. Furthermore, these tools allow you to integrate search with
- browsing. If you have several nested directories which the user may
- browse, you can include the glimpse interface in each document such that
- only the relevant directories will be included in the search. More
- details are given below.
- The current version of GlimpseHTTP was
- tested under httpd 1.2 HTML server from NCSA and
- Glimpse currently works on many Unix platforms.
- To search and browse the information any HTML browser can be used
- (this includes NCSA Mosaic for X-Windows, MS-Windows and
- Macintosh, Lynx and other browsers. For maximum convenience
- your browser should support forms, although minimal
- functionality can be achieved with any browser).

- Since GlimpseHTTP uses Glimpse, this provides some unique features
-
- - A very small index (3-5% of the total text).
- - Reasonably fast search.
- - Search for approximate match allowing errors.
-
- In addition, GlimpseHTTP provides you with the following
- capabilities:
-
- - You can use a combination of browsing and searching:
- first, you locate the directory where the relevant
- information can be stored, then you can use search
- to locate specific files.
- - The result of the search is a nicely formatted hypertext with
- hyperlinks to matching documents.
- - Following the hyperlink leads you not only to a particular
- file, but also to the exact place where the match occured.
- - Hyperlinks in the documents are converted on the fly to
- actual hyperlinks, which you can follow immediately. This
- makes the GlimpseHTTP particularily suitable for searching
- meta-information (Internet directories etc.).
- - Similar tools are provided for archiving and searching
- USENET newsgroups. You can maintain the archive of news articles
- and allow people to search your archive using the
- same interface. Features supported include kill-file for articles
- and fast search for particular posters. Since news archiver uses
- NNTP interface, you can archive news articles from remote
- news servers. (Browse and search for news is yet to be
- implemented: browsing in this case means selection of pertinent
- newsgroup(s), currently supported is only the search within
- one newsgroup a time)

- Among the possible applications of GlimpseHTTP we envision:
-
- - FTP sites with search possibilities;
- - news archiving sites;
- - any search application which should be accessed over local
- or global network where searching for approximate match and/or
- saving of disk space for indices is an issue.
-
- GlimpseHTTP components:
-
- 1. aglimpse - "Archive Glimpse" - a tool for searching file
- hierarchies indexed for Glimpse. aglimpse is a CGI-compliant
- program which performs the search and formats the output as
- HTML document with hyperlinks to the matches.
-
- 2. Administrative tools which facilitate maintaining and
- indexing of Glimpse archives. One of the programs is the
- HTML indexer which prepares hypertext indices for
- each searchable directory - this supports the concept
- of combined browsing and searching.
-
- 3. GlimpseNews - a collection of tools for archiving and
- searching newsgroups archives.
